An opportunity exists for Assurance and Verification Specialists with UAV or aircraft systems centric test and integration background to become part of the BDA Engineering Team. As a test and integration specialist you will play a key role in supporting the development of a globally-significant program that will deliver a disruptive advantage to support Defence operational capabilities.
This opportunity is based in Brisbane QLD for technical specialists to join the rapidly growing Assurance & Verification Engineering Team. You will be working with UAV control systems to perform systems test and verification, supporting the Air Power Teaming System (ATS)/ MQ-28A Ghost Bat program. The position is a hands-on role, working within a dynamic test team, developing test and evaluation activities on protype ground based systems.

**Responsibilities**:

- Assist in gathering and analyzing customer and stakeholder requirements to support the development of test plans
- Develop detailed test and verification procedures including configuration definition, needed to perform test and minimize risk
- Perform test in accordance with approved test plan/procedure. Troubleshoot and address anomalies. Make suggestions based on emergent conditions.
- Prepare and publish test reports to document test results and satisfy requirements
